Easy Tricks To Open Stubborn Plastic Honey Jar Lids Effortlessly

how to get the lid off a plastic honey jar

Removing the lid from a plastic honey jar can sometimes be a sticky challenge due to the tight seal and the natural tendency of honey to create a vacuum. To tackle this, start by running the lid under hot water for about 30 seconds to loosen the seal, as heat expands the plastic and reduces suction. Alternatively, gently tap the lid against a countertop or use a rubber grip pad to enhance your grip and twist it open. If the lid remains stubborn, try using a butter knife or a jar opener tool to pry it loose, being careful not to damage the jar. Patience and the right technique will ensure you can access your honey without frustration or mess.

Grip enhancement techniques for slippery lids

Plastic honey jar lids often resist opening due to tight seals, sticky residue, or smooth surfaces that defy grip. Enhancing your hold on these slippery lids requires a blend of texture modification and leverage optimization. Start by cleaning the lid’s edge with a damp cloth to remove any honey residue, as even a thin film can reduce friction. Next, wrap a thin rubber band around the lid’s perimeter, creating a textured surface that your fingers can grip more effectively. For stubborn lids, use a wider band or double-layer for added traction. This simple, low-cost method transforms a smooth plastic surface into a grippable one, making it easier to twist the lid open without slipping.

Another effective technique involves leveraging everyday items to amplify your grip. A silicone oven mitt or a piece of non-slip shelf liner can provide the necessary friction to counteract the lid’s slipperiness. Place the mitt or liner over the lid, ensuring it covers the entire surface, and apply steady, downward pressure while twisting counterclockwise. Alternatively, a piece of sandpaper or emery cloth can be used to roughen the lid’s edge temporarily, though this method may not be suitable for lids with delicate finishes. These tools act as force multipliers, reducing the effort required to break the seal and open the jar.

For those who prefer a more hands-on approach, modifying your grip technique can make a significant difference. Instead of using just your fingertips, engage your entire hand by placing your palm flat against the lid and using your thumb and fingers to create a pinching motion. This distributes the force more evenly, reducing the risk of slipping. Additionally, applying heat to the lid’s edge with warm water or a hairdryer can cause the plastic to expand slightly, loosening the seal. Be cautious not to overheat, as excessive temperatures can warp the plastic or affect the honey’s consistency.

Comparing grip enhancement techniques reveals that the most effective solutions combine texture improvement with mechanical advantage. For instance, using a rubber band in conjunction with a twisting tool, such as a jar opener or the base of a sturdy spoon, maximizes both friction and leverage. This hybrid approach addresses the dual challenges of slipperiness and tight seals, making it ideal for particularly stubborn jars. By experimenting with these methods, you can identify the combination that works best for your specific jar and grip strength, ensuring a frustration-free experience every time.

Leveraging tools like rubber bands or gloves

A simple rubber band can be a game-changer when it comes to opening a stubborn plastic honey jar. The key lies in its ability to provide extra grip, transforming slippery surfaces into a more manageable challenge. To leverage this tool, stretch a wide rubber band around the lid's circumference, ensuring it sits flat against the jar's surface. This creates a textured, non-slip grip that allows you to apply more force without the lid twisting in your hand. For optimal results, use a rubber band with a width of at least 1/4 inch, as thinner bands may roll or bunch under pressure.

Gloves, particularly those with textured palms, offer another practical solution for jar-opening woes. Latex, rubber, or gardening gloves with raised patterns can significantly enhance your grip, making it easier to twist off tight lids. The tactile surface of these gloves increases friction, reducing the likelihood of the jar slipping. For instance, a pair of standard dishwashing gloves with ribbed palms can provide the necessary traction to open a plastic honey jar with minimal effort. This method is especially useful for individuals with limited hand strength or those dealing with particularly stubborn jars.

Comparing rubber bands and gloves, both tools excel in different scenarios. Rubber bands are ideal for quick fixes and can be easily stored in a kitchen drawer for immediate access. They are also disposable, making them a hygienic choice for those concerned about cross-contamination. Gloves, on the other hand, offer a more ergonomic solution, distributing the force evenly across the hand and reducing strain on individual fingers. For repeated use or more challenging jars, gloves may be the more sustainable and comfortable option.

Tapping the lid to break the vacuum seal

A sharp rap on the lid of a plastic honey jar can sometimes be the key to breaking the stubborn vacuum seal. This method leverages the principle of creating a sudden change in pressure to dislodge the lid. The vacuum inside the jar is what makes it difficult to open, as the air pressure outside is greater than the pressure inside, effectively sucking the lid tighter. By tapping the lid, you introduce a force that can momentarily equalize the pressure, allowing the seal to release.

To execute this technique effectively, hold the jar firmly in one hand and use the heel of your other hand or a spoon to strike the lid sharply. Aim for the edge of the lid where it meets the jar, as this is where the seal is most vulnerable. A single, firm tap is often sufficient, but if the lid doesn’t budge, try repeating the process a few times. Be cautious not to strike too hard, as excessive force can damage the lid or jar, especially if it’s made of thin plastic.

This method is particularly useful for jars with smooth, non-textured lids that lack grip. It’s also a quick solution when you don’t have tools like rubber gloves or a jar opener at hand. However, it’s less effective on jars with deeply recessed lids or those with extremely tight seals. In such cases, combining tapping with other techniques, like running the lid under hot water, can improve your chances of success.

One practical tip is to place a towel or cloth over the lid before tapping to prevent slipping and provide a better grip. This also cushions the impact, reducing the risk of cracking the jar. For older adults or individuals with limited hand strength, using a utensil like a spoon or butter knife to tap the lid can provide more leverage and control.
